Quest for Fire (French: La Guerre du feu) is a 1981 prehistoric fantasy adventure film directed by Jean-Jacques Annaud, written by Gérard Brach and starring Everett McGill, Ron Perlman, Nameer El-Kadi and Rae Dawn Chong.
Quest for Fire is a 1981 prehistoric fantasy adventure film directed by Jean-Jacques Annaud. The story is set in Paleolithic Europe, with its plot surrounding the struggle for control of fire...
